MARKET INSIGHTS
Global Digital Dental X-Ray Radiography Equipment market size was valued at USD 457 million in 2024. The market is projected to reach USD 585 million by 2031, exhibiting a CAGR of 3.7% during the forecast period.
Digital Dental X-Ray Radiography Equipment refers to imaging systems that utilize digital radiography principles specifically for dental applications. These devices, often simply called digital x-rays, enable dentists to detect hidden dental issues such as structural anomalies, benign or malignant masses, bone loss, and cavities with greater precision and reduced radiation exposure compared to traditional methods.
The market is driven by rising global healthcare spending, which accounts for about 10% of GDP and continues to climb due to aging populations and increasing chronic diseases. According to research, the broader medical devices sector reached USD 603 billion in 2023 and is expected to grow at a 5% CAGR over the next six years. Advancements in imaging technology and growing awareness of early diagnosis further propel demand. Key players like Dentsply Sirona, Carestream, and PLANMECA OY dominate with innovative portfolios, while challenges include high costs and regulatory hurdles. For instance, recent integrations of AI in imaging software are enhancing diagnostic accuracy, supporting sustained expansion.

Radiation Safety Concerns and Maintenance Demands to Restrain Growth
Although digital dental X-ray radiography equipment offers lower radiation doses than analog counterparts typically 80-90% less lingering concerns about cumulative exposure continue to restrain broader acceptance. Dental professionals must adhere to ALARA principles (As Low As Reasonably Achievable), which, while promoting safety, necessitate additional shielding and monitoring protocols that add to operational complexity. This caution is especially pronounced in pediatric and pregnant patient care, where even minimal risks are scrutinized, potentially limiting routine use in certain demographics.
Maintenance requirements represent another significant restraint, as these high-tech devices demand regular calibration and updates to sustain performance. Failures in sensors or software glitches can disrupt workflows, leading to costly repairs that strain budgets in resource-limited clinics. The ordinary type, dominant in the market, is particularly vulnerable to wear from frequent use, exacerbating downtime in busy environments.
Furthermore, the reliance on specialized service networks for upkeep poses challenges in remote or rural areas, where access to technicians is limited. These factors collectively temper the market's expansion, despite its overall positive trajectory at a 3.7% CAGR.

Regional Analysis: Digital Dental X-Ray Radiography Equipment MarketEurope
Europe's digital dental X-ray equipment market demonstrates maturity and stability. The market is characterized by the widespread adoption of digital imaging and a gradual transition from computed radiography (CR) to direct digital radiography (DR) systems. Environmental regulations are increasingly influencing product design, with a push toward more energy-efficient and recyclable equipment. The market shows strength in integrated software solutions, with dental practice management software often including imaging modules. Eastern Europe continues to show stronger growth rates than Western Europe, particularly in EU member states that have recently joined. The market faces challenges from an aging population of dentists and economic pressures on healthcare spending, yet remains a stable and significant market.
Asia-Pacific
The Asia-Pacific market is characterized by extreme diversity, from the highly developed Japanese market to emerging economies across Southeast Asia. Japan and South Korea represent mature markets with high adoption rates and a preference for premium equipment. Meanwhile, countries like Indonesia, Vietnam, and the Philippines are experiencing rapid growth driven by expanding healthcare access and dental insurance coverage. India represents a special case with its combination of low-cost manufacturing and vast population, creating both a substantial production hub and massive consumer market. The region benefits from cross-border technology transfer, particularly from Japan and South Korea to other Asian countries. Regulatory harmonization efforts are gradually improving but remain a challenge for international manufacturers.
Latin America
Latin America's digital dental X-ray market shows interesting regional variations. Mexico and Brazil dominate, accounting for the majority of both sales and manufacturing. Argentina and Chile show stronger growth rates but from smaller bases. The region is characterized by a high percentage of small, independent dental practices rather than corporate chains, which affects purchasing patterns and brand preferences. Economic instability and currency fluctuations heavily influence the market, with many dentists preferring equipment from manufacturers with local currency pricing or stable regional distributors. The market shows a faster-than-average transition from analog to digital, particularly in intraoral radiography.
Middle East & Africa
The Middle East and African markets present the largest growth opportunity but also the most significant challenges. The Gulf Cooperation Council (GCC) countries represent high-value markets with demand for premium equipment but limited volume. Sub-Saharan Africa shows potential for mobile and portable dental X-ray solutions but remains constrained by infrastructure limitations. The market is characterized by a strong presence of Chinese and Indian equipment at various price points, alongside European and American premium products. The market shows increasing interest in refurbished and reconditioned equipment as a means to expand access to digital dental radiography. Regional conflicts and economic instability remain significant barriers to market development.
